Before you visit

  • Most services now require an appointment. Call ahead at (866) 770-2345 or 1-800-772-1213 to book one.
  • Bring a photo ID and your Social Security number.
  • Bring original documents for your request, for a new or replacement card, proof of identity and citizenship or immigration status.
  • Many tasks don't need a visit: replace a card, get a benefit letter, or update direct deposit online at ssa.gov.

Services at the La Crosse Social Security office

Staff at the La Crosse office handle the full range of Social Security business, including:

  • Apply for a new or replacement Social Security card
  • Apply for retirement, disability (SSDI), or SSI benefits
  • Change your name on your Social Security record
  • Update direct deposit and mailing address
  • Request proof of benefits or a benefit verification letter
  • Get help enrolling in Medicare
  • Check the status of an application or appeal

Can I replace my Social Security card without visiting the La Crosse office?
In most states you can request a replacement card online with a free my Social Security account at ssa.gov, no office visit needed. You can also check applications, request benefit letters, and update direct deposit there.
